What is C0053?
The diagnostic trouble code (DTC) C0053 refers to an issue with the Anti-lock Braking System (ABS) wheel speed sensor on a vehicle. This code indicates that the ABS module has detected a malfunction in one of the wheel speed sensors, which are crucial for the proper functioning of the ABS system. When the ABS system detects irregularities in the speed readings from the sensors, it triggers the C0053 code. This usually occurs in vehicles equipped with advanced braking systems, such as the 2013-2017 Ford Fusion or the 2014-2018 Chevrolet Silverado. The implications of this code can be significant, as it can lead to erratic braking behavior, increased stopping distances, or even total failure of the ABS system. It's important for car owners to address this code promptly, as it not only affects braking performance but can also lead to further complications if left unresolved. The vehicle's stability and handling may also be compromised, especially in adverse weather conditions where traction control is essential. Symptoms
Common symptoms when C0053 is present:
- The ABS warning light remains illuminated on the dashboard, indicating a malfunction in the anti-lock braking system.
- Drivers may experience a pulsating brake pedal during normal braking, suggesting that the ABS is attempting to engage improperly.
- There may be noticeable differences in braking performance, such as longer stopping distances or a lack of responsiveness.
- In some cases, traction control may become disabled, preventing the system from assisting in maintaining vehicle stability.
- Unusual sounds, such as clicking or grinding noises, may occur when engaging the brakes, indicating potential issues with the ABS components.
Possible Causes
Most common causes of C0053 (ordered by frequency):
- The most common cause is a faulty wheel speed sensor, which accounts for about 60% of C0053 occurrences. This could be due to damage, corrosion, or dirt affecting sensor performance.
- A malfunctioning ABS module can also trigger this code, as it is responsible for interpreting the signals from the wheel speed sensors. This could lead to a failure in processing the necessary data for proper ABS functioning.
- Wiring issues, such as frayed or broken wires leading to the sensor, may cause intermittent or complete sensor failures. Regular inspections can help identify these issues before they escalate.
- Less common causes include damaged reluctor rings (the part of the wheel speed sensor that detects speed), which can affect sensor readings and lead to the C0053 error.
- Rarely, software issues in the ABS control module may also result in false readings, leading to the illumination of the C0053 code.

Real Repair Case Studies
Case Study 1: Fixing a C0053 Code on a 2016 Ford Fusion
Vehicle: 2016 Ford Fusion, 75,000 miles
Problem: Customer reported the ABS warning light was on and brakes felt unresponsive.
Diagnosis: After scanning with GeekOBD APP and visually inspecting, the front left wheel speed sensor was found to be damaged.
Solution: Replaced the front left wheel speed sensor, cleared the code, and verified functionality through a road test.
Cost: $150 (sensor cost: $100, labor: $50)
Result: ABS warning light turned off, and the brakes functioned correctly after the repair.
Case Study 2: Resolving C0053 on a 2014 Chevrolet Silverado
Vehicle: 2014 Chevrolet Silverado, 90,000 miles
Problem: Customer experienced pulsating brakes and an illuminated ABS light.
Diagnosis: Diagnosis revealed a fault in the ABS module after running tests with GeekOBD APP.
Solution: Replaced the ABS module and recalibrated the system to ensure correct operation.
Cost: $900 (module cost: $600, labor: $300)
Result: The ABS system was fully restored, and the customer reported no further issues.
